Prospects for Turkmen-Pakistani cooperation discussed in Islamabad
17:19 13.04.2026 854
A meeting with representatives of the Lahore Chamber of Commerce and Industry, led by its Secretary General, Shahid Khalil, was held at the Embassy of Turkmenistan in Islamabad.
During the meeting, representatives of the Lahore Chamber of Commerce and Industry expressed interest in strengthening working contacts with the Embassy of Turkmenistan to explore opportunities for expanding practical cooperation between the business communities of the two countries.
In turn, the Turkmen side informed the delegation of the reforms being implemented by the Turkmen leadership, which are providing a powerful impetus to the development of foreign trade relations and facilitating the country's deeper integration into the global economic space.
In this context, Turkmenistan's growing trade and export potential, based on its significant natural gas reserves, as well as the export of petroleum products, textiles, and agricultural products, was noted.
Special attention was paid to the international business forums planned for this year, which are bringing together hundreds of business representatives from around the world.
At the end of the meeting, the parties confirmed their interest in expanding mutually beneficial trade between the two countries and in the participation of business representatives in joint forums and exhibitions aimed at further strengthening bilateral cooperation, according to the International Information Center of Turkmenistan.
